Behind every modern embassy or overseas project we support, there’s a dedicated Procurement team here in the UK making it all happen. They strive to provide value for money supply chains in a compliant manner to support the organisation, FCDO and our wider market customers, shaping strategies for sustainable and ethical sourcing. And now, you've got the opportunity to join them.
Procurement at FCDO Services is busy, fast-paced and highly collaborative, and when you join one of our buying teams you’ll follow our policies and regulations as you work to provide a service of the very highest quality. Directing, engaging, coaching, managing and developing your team, and ensuring key performance measures are met, you’ll review requisitions for accuracy and compliance before gaining approval from Senior Managers. Operating within a delegated authority limit, you’ll also work with your Purchasing Manager to increase customer satisfaction and engagement with the team.
Committed to ensuring business compliance with relevant procurement policies, and identifying solutions to ongoing issues and trends by undertaking monthly and quarterly reviews of team reporting and analysis, we’ll expect you to provide professional advice on any escalated matters. You’ll also support your colleagues in external and internal audits, deliver scheduled reports and manage business processes. Acting as the team’s Information Asset Manager, you’ll ensure that all data is stored correctly, identify risks and suggest mitigations, and work to identify efficiencies and opportunities to collaborate buying activities.
In this important role, you’ll be part of a growing centralised buying function at FCDO Services, joining us at a point where the team is shaping how purchasing support will work in the future. An inspirational and motivating communicator with superb customer service skills, you’ll be an imaginative problem solver and have the confidence to work with managers at all levels of our global organisation. Capable of meeting tight deadlines and performance targets without direct supervision, you should also have well developed experience of line management or its equivalent, an aptitude for change and a readiness to continually look for process improvements to create efficiencies.
Your excellent writing skills will allow you to produce clear, concise reports and briefings for internal stakeholders, and some knowledge of business performance management and commercial processes would be desirable. In addition, an understanding of the Enterprise Resource Planning platform and systems we use for our core finance operations would be a bonus.
